// Check that invocation immediately under declaration statement as initializer (Parenthesized Expression is allowed)
        private bool IsInvocationInitializer()
        {
            var expression                  = myInvocationExpression.GetContainingParenthesizedExpression();
            var currentInitializer          = ExpressionInitializerNavigator.GetByValue(expression);
            var selectedDeclarator          = LocalVariableDeclarationNavigator.GetByInitial(currentInitializer);
            var multiplyVariableDeclaration = MultipleLocalVariableDeclarationNavigator.GetByDeclarator(selectedDeclarator);

            return(DeclarationStatementNavigator.GetByDeclaration(multiplyVariableDeclaration) != null);
        }

        public static void RenameOldUsages([NotNull] ICSharpExpression originExpression,
                                           [CanBeNull] IDeclaredElement localVariableDeclaredElement,
                                           [NotNull] string newName, [NotNull] CSharpElementFactory factory)
        {
            originExpression.GetPsiServices().Locks.AssertReadAccessAllowed();

            var statement = ExpressionStatementNavigator.GetByExpression(originExpression);

            if (statement != null)
            {
                statement.RemoveOrReplaceByEmptyStatement();
            }
            else
            {
                if (localVariableDeclaredElement == null)
                {
                    originExpression.ReplaceBy(factory.CreateReferenceExpression(newName));
                }
                else if (!newName.Equals(localVariableDeclaredElement.ShortName))
                {
                    var provider = DefaultUsagesProvider.Instance;
                    var usages   = provider.GetUsages(localVariableDeclaredElement,
                                                      originExpression.GetContainingNode <IMethodDeclaration>().NotNull("scope != null"));
                    originExpression.GetContainingStatement().NotNull("expression.GetContainingStatement() != null")
                    .RemoveOrReplaceByEmptyStatement();
                    foreach (var usage in usages)
                    {
                        if (usage.IsValid() && usage is IReferenceExpression node)
                        {
                            node.ReplaceBy(factory.CreateReferenceExpression(newName));
                        }
                    }
                }
                else
                {
                    DeclarationStatementNavigator.GetByVariableDeclaration(
                        LocalVariableDeclarationNavigator.GetByInitial(
                            ExpressionInitializerNavigator.GetByValue(
                                originExpression.GetContainingParenthesizedExpression())))
                    ?.RemoveOrReplaceByEmptyStatement();
                }
            }
        }
